The Itinerary in Detail

Starting Point: The journey begins with a drive along the Sorrento coastline, offering a preview of the coast’s rugged beauty. The driver will take you through the winding roads that hug the cliffs, giving you plenty of chances to admire the views from your window.

Positano: The first major stop is the vertical town of Positano. Known worldwide for its colorful buildings stacked on the hillside, this is a place to walk through narrow alleys, browse boutique shops, and snap those picture-perfect shots of the cascading houses and the sea below. You’ll get about two hours for exploration—ample time to enjoy a coffee or a quick stroll. One review highlights how the guide’s descriptions made the drive even more memorable, adding context to the stunning scenery.

The Drive Along the Coast: After Positano, the journey continues along the coast, passing by Praiano, Furore, and Conca dei Marini. This stretch offers spectacular views over the water and cliffs, making every turn a photo opportunity. The highlight here is the Li Galli island, visible from the road, famous for its celebrity visitors and legendary reputation.

Amalfi: Next is Amalfi itself, a historic maritime town. Here, you’ll have free time to visit the main square, the Cathedral of St. Andrew, and to sample local street food. The tour suggests about two hours in Amalfi, enough to wander the streets, soak in the lively atmosphere, and maybe pick up a few souvenirs. One guest describes their visit as a chance to enjoy “the city center and taste the local street food,” painting a picture of a lively, authentic experience.

Ravello: The final stop is Ravello, perched high above the coast. Known for its lush villas and panoramic vistas, you’ll have about one hour to visit Villa Rufolo and relax in the main square. The peaceful atmosphere here contrasts with the bustling towns below, making it a perfect spot to wind down after a busy day.

The Practicalities

Price and Value: At roughly $330 per person, the cost might seem high, but it covers private transport, guided commentary, and the convenience of door-to-door service. For travelers who want to avoid navigating narrow roads or public buses, this is a real plus. The reviews suggest that the experience is memorable and worth the investment, especially considering the personalized service.

Duration and Timing: Starting in the morning and lasting about 7 to 8 hours makes it manageable for most travelers. The tour is flexible enough to accommodate those wanting a full, immersive day without feeling rushed.

Booking in Advance: The tour is popular, often booked around 93 days ahead, which indicates a good level of demand. Planning early is advisable if you want to secure your preferred date.

Accessibility: The tour mentions being near public transportation and that most travelers can participate, which is good news for those with mobility considerations, although walking around towns with steep streets can be challenging.

Cancellation Policy: Free cancellation up to 24 hours before departure is helpful if your plans change unexpectedly.
